What is UV-C or Germicidal UV Light?
Germicidal UV or UV-C belongs to the ultraviolet range best understood for its ability to inactivate virus like infections and microorganisms. It makes use of specific wavelengths of the ultraviolet spectrum, normally in between 200 to 280 nanometers.
Germicidal UV is commonly made use of to sanitize surface areas and spaces. COVID-19 can survive on particular surface areas for up to three days, so it’s essential to sanitize at routine intervals.

Does UV Light Kill Germs?
The three primary kinds of UV rays are UVA, UVB, and also UVC. Because UVC rays have the quickest wavelength, as well as as a result highest power, they can eliminating bacteria and infections, also called virus. How To Clean Germs From Iphone
UVC light has a wavelength of between 200 as well as 400 nanometres (nm). It is extremely reliable at decontamination since it ruins the molecular bonds that hold with each other the DNA of infections and also germs, consisting of “superbugs,” which have established a more powerful resistance to anti-biotics.
Effective UVC light has actually been on a regular basis used to decontaminate medical tools and also medical facility rooms. A research study that consisted of 21,000 individuals that remained over night in an area where someone had actually been formerly treated located that sanitizing a health center space with UV light in enhancement to standard approaches of cleaning cut transmission of drug-resistant microorganisms by 30%.
Since UVC light can properly sanitize hard-to-clean spaces and also crannies, this is partly. UVC light also works by destroying the DNA of virus, which makes it efficient against “superbugs.”.
Researchers have recently been dealing with narrow-spectrum UVC rays (207-222 nm). This kind of UVC light kills microorganisms as well as infections without penetrating the outer cell layer of human skin.

A 2017 research revealed that 222 nm UVC light eliminated meth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A) bacteria equally as effectively as a 254 nm UVC light, which would be toxic to people. This research was duplicated in 2018 on the H1N1 virus, and also narrow-spectrum UVC light was once again located to be reliable at getting rid of the virus.
This has particularly crucial implications for public health and wellness because the opportunity of safe overhead UV illumination in public spaces can substantially minimize the transmission of illness.
Eliminating microorganisms and also infections with UV light is particularly reliable due to the fact that it kills bacteria despite medication resistance and also without toxic chemicals. It is likewise efficient against all germs, even newly-emerging pathogen pressures.
Can Germicidal UV Light Kill Viruses?
Germicidal UV lights can really change the DNA and RNA of viruses and germs, destroying their capability to replicate. How To Clean Germs From Iphone
Viruses are not living microorganisms, so germicidal UV can not technically “eliminate” them. Instead, we can say germicidal UV “inactivates” infections, while it does kill germs.
Bacteria might be immune to various other points like antibiotics, yet can not develop a resistance to UV light.
Can UV Lights Inactivate COVID-19?
Screening is very restricted however is currently ongoing because this is a novel (or new) coronavirus. The framework of COVID-19 is various from past infections. Therefore, there is insufficient information to state that UV lights can inactivate COVID-19.
Here is what researchers do understand. Pathogens can be ranked based upon their resistance to anti-bacterials, like germicidal UV. Coronaviruses fall under the group of “enveloped viruses,” or a Class 3. Class 3 infections are the easiest to do away with.
Products that are able to suspend even more resilient viruses like tiny and also big non-enveloped viruses (Class 1 & 2 infections) ought to likewise be effective against surrounded viruses like coronaviruses. Several UV product makers say their items can kill most Class 1 viruses.
Based upon this information, germicidal UV is believed to be efficient versus COVID-19.
Is UV Light Safe?
Current studies show particular wavelengths of UV light may be much safer than others while still targeting microorganisms and also infections.
Far-UVC lamps make use of a narrow variety of UV-C wavelengths, from 207 to 222 nm.
Far-UVC is believed to be equally as reliable at killing bacteria as higher series of UV-C light, however much less damaging to our skin as well as eyes.
One research study in particular concentrates on making use of far-UVC light. The research study ended that 222 nm UV can suspend microorganisms yet not permeate the skin.

Exactly How Do UV Light Sanitizers Work?
On the UV light spectrum there are UV-A, B, as well as C lights. Just the UV-C light can eliminate bacteria, claims Philip Tierno, PhD, a clinical professor in the department of pathology at New York University Langone Medical.
” This light has a series of performance, which interferes and ruins the nucleic acids of germs and various other germs,” Tierno described, adding that the variety of light can also interrupt healthy proteins in the microorganisms by killing certain amino acids. They function best on smooth surface areas and have limitations, Tierno suggested.
” UV-C permeates ostensibly, and also the light can not enter into crannies and spaces,” he described. That includes points like buttons or phone situations, which are lined with holes. If a germ is enclosed within a food particle, for instance, the UV light will not be able to obtain at it.
” These kill microbes quickly,” Michael Schmidt said. “But when your gadget appears, it’s just as risk-free as its last experience.” To put it simply, utilizing the UV light sanitizer does not certify you to obtain dirty as well as disregard feasible brand-new germs on the phone.

How UV Light Kills Microbes
Infections don’t duplicate on their very own, however they do have genetic material, either DNA or RNA. They reproduce by connecting to cells and infusing their DNA. Some viruses break out of the infected cell (this type of reproduction is called the lytic cycle), while others combine into the infected cell, replicating every single time that cell splits (lysogenic).
If you’ve ever obtained a sunburn, you’ve had a preference of just how UV light kills viruses: UV light can harm DNA. A DNA molecule is made of two hairs bound together by 4 bases, adenine (A), cytosine (C), guanine (G), and thymine (T). These bases resemble an alphabet, and also their sequence types directions for cells to reproduce.
UV light can cause thymine bases to fuse with each other, clambering the DNA sequence and also essentially tossing a wrench right into the equipment. Considering that the DNA sequence is no more correct, it can no much longer replicate properly. This is just how UV light wipes out viruses, by destroying their ability to recreate.
